What Makes a Gift Truly Weird?
Now, let's ponder the question: what truly makes a gift weird? It's not just about the item itself, but the confluence of factors that contribute to its oddity. Context, personal preferences, and the giver's intentions all play a role in determining whether a gift falls into the category of bizarre.
One key element is the element of surprise. A gift that is completely unexpected, either in its nature or its timing, is more likely to be considered weird. Imagine receiving a taxidermied squirrel as a wedding gift, or a set of encyclopedias for your 100th birthday. These are the kinds of gifts that catch you off guard and leave you wondering, “Where did that come from?” The unexpectedness can be both amusing and disconcerting, adding to the gift's overall weirdness.
Another factor is the disconnect between the gift and the recipient's interests. A gift that is completely unrelated to the recipient's hobbies, passions, or lifestyle is likely to be perceived as odd. A vegetarian receiving a meat-lover's cookbook, or a minimalist being gifted a collection of knick-knacks – these are the kinds of mismatches that can make a gift seem peculiar. The greater the disconnect, the weirder the gift seems.
The giver's intentions also play a crucial role. A gift that is given with malicious intent is obviously not just weird, but also hurtful. However, even gifts given with the best of intentions can fall into the category of weird if they miss the mark. A well-meaning but misguided attempt to be helpful, funny, or thoughtful can sometimes result in a present that is simply bizarre. The intentions behind the gift may be good, but the execution leaves much to be desired.
Personal preferences are another key consideration. What one person considers a thoughtful gift, another might deem incredibly weird. Tastes vary widely, and a gift that aligns with one person's aesthetic sensibilities might clash horribly with another's. A gaudy decorative item, a piece of abstract art, or a brightly colored piece of clothing – these are the kinds of gifts that can be highly subjective, with some people finding them charming and others finding them bizarre.
The context of the gift-giving occasion also matters. A gift that is appropriate for one occasion might be completely out of place for another. A gag gift at a white elephant exchange is perfectly acceptable, but the same gift given as a serious birthday present might be considered weird. The occasion sets the tone for the gift, and a mismatch between the gift and the occasion can contribute to its oddness.
In the end, what makes a gift truly weird is a complex interplay of factors. It's a combination of surprise, disconnect, intentions, personal preferences, and context that determines whether a gift falls into the realm of the unusual. And while weird gifts may not always be the most practical or the most appreciated, they are often the most memorable, providing us with stories to tell and anecdotes to share.
